The Global Chromatography Accessories & Consumables Market, valued at approximately USD 4.87 billion in 2024, is projected to advance at a CAGR of 4.22% over the forecast period 2025-2035, reaching USD 7.67 billion by 2035. Chromatography has cemented its position as a cornerstone analytical technology in diverse industries, underpinning critical quality control, drug development, food safety, and environmental monitoring processes. Accessories and consumables-ranging from precision-engineered columns and high-purity filters to durable vials and frits-are indispensable in ensuring analytical reliability and throughput. The escalating demand for personalized medicines, biopharmaceutical breakthroughs, and stringent regulatory frameworks governing product purity have been instrumental in driving market growth. Continuous innovations in chromatography media, coupled with automation and miniaturization trends, are further enhancing performance efficiency, paving the way for widespread adoption across both research and industrial settings.
An upward shift in global R&D investments, particularly in pharmaceutical and biotechnology sectors, has intensified the consumption of chromatography consumables. For example, the surge in biologics, biosimilars, and novel therapeutic modalities has placed chromatography at the epicenter of purification and analytical workflows. Simultaneously, food and beverage companies are deploying advanced chromatography setups to comply with evolving safety standards, while environmental laboratories increasingly utilize high-resolution chromatographic methods to detect trace contaminants. Advancements such as ultra-high performance liquid chromatography (UHPLC), improved stationary phases, and eco-friendly solvent systems are not only improving separation efficiency but also reducing operational costs and environmental footprints. Nevertheless, the high capital investment in advanced chromatography systems and the recurring cost of consumables could temper market penetration in cost-sensitive regions.
From a geographical perspective, North America maintained its dominance in 2025, supported by a robust pharmaceutical manufacturing ecosystem, extensive research infrastructure, and a strong emphasis on analytical quality control. The U.S., with its dense network of CROs, academic research institutes, and regulatory-driven compliance culture, accounts for a substantial share of global consumption. Europe follows closely, driven by innovation clusters in countries such as Germany, Switzerland, and the UK, where chromatography technologies are integral to both life sciences and industrial applications. Meanwhile, Asia Pacific is emerging as the fastest-growing region, fueled by the pharmaceutical manufacturing boom in China and India, expanding biotech investments in South Korea and Japan, and increasing adoption in food quality testing. Supportive government initiatives, the proliferation of contract manufacturing, and the rapid establishment of advanced testing laboratories are catalyzing regional demand. Latin America and the Middle East & Africa, though smaller in scale, are witnessing steady adoption rates as local industries upgrade their analytical capabilities to meet export and quality compliance requirements.
